Rebecca Malope is definitely leadership and the country is buzzing following her appearance on Sunday night's episode of Idols SA.

Ma Ribs had the audience dancing in the aisles and singing their hearts out when she took to the stage, making us all forget that there was actually a talent competition going on.

The gospel superstar roped in the top five to lift the country’s mood with her hit song Moya Wam and was backed by the Soweto Gospel Choir. The contestants then picked up from where she left off with their own gospel renditions

Ma Ribs later returned to show off her signature “wiping the floor” dance move.

King B fans got a fright when their fave was up against Niyaaz for elimination. He survived and gave a powerful rendition of Lebo Sekgobela’s Lion of Judah that brought many, including  Unathi to tears.

"You got the first cry this season, so you’ve done something right," Somizi pointed out.

Yanga once again had the audience in their feels when she delivered an emotional performance of Sjava's Impilo while paying tribute to Reeva Steenkamp, Karabo Mokoena & Cheryl Zondi.
